Traffic delays on M8 at Glasgow Fort as drivers queue for shops reopening

There are delays on the M8 motorway this morning with drivers queuing for Glasgow Fort as shops reopen.

With our city entering level 3 lockdown today, non-essential shops across the city have been permitted to welcome in customers once more since 6am.

Although the city centre has been relatively quiet so far this morning, it appears Glaswegians are heading to the Fort for their Christmas shopping.

Traffic Scotland say: " #M8 westbound J10 offslip for @glasgowfort.

"Traffic now queuing onto the motorway."

"#ExpectDelays heading that way and #TakeCare on your approach."

Under level 3 lockdown, travel restrictions remain in place meaning people from outwith Glasgow cannot travel to the city to go shopping.
